Grade Levels

Primary School

Children typically attend primary school from Reception to Year 6.


Secondary School

Secondary School - After primary school, students move on to secondary school, typically covering Year 7 to Year 11


Further Education

Further Education - After completing their compulsory education, students can pursue further education in colleges or sixth forms, often preparing for A-level exams.


Higher Education

Higher Education - This includes universities, where students can pursue undergraduate (bachelor's degree), postgraduate (master's degree), and doctoral (doctorate) degrees.
